Sunday 23 October 2016

The Enchanting Falls

The enchanting Sezibwa falls is another breath talking water fall in Uganda, its found in Mukono district it is situated only 200 miles on the from the Kampla Jinja highway.The fall preserves an ancient African culture and has for ages been a site of tradition cultural rituals.


No comments:

Post a Comment